When did guidance and counseling started in Nigeria?

Guidance and counseling in Nigeria began to take shape in the 1950s, primarily within educational institutions as a response to the increasing need for student support. The establishment of formal counseling services was further influenced by the introduction of Western education and the recognition of the importance of mental health and career guidance. By the 1970s, guidance and counseling gained more prominence with government initiatives and the integration of these services into school systems. Today, it plays a crucial role in the educational framework across the country.


What is the importance of interview to guidance and counseling?

Interviews are crucial in guidance and counseling as they facilitate open communication between the counselor and the individual, allowing for a deeper understanding of the individual's needs, concerns, and goals. They help establish rapport and trust, essential for effective counseling. Additionally, interviews enable counselors to gather pertinent information to tailor their approaches and interventions, ultimately leading to more effective support and guidance.

History of guidance and counseling in Kenya?

Guidance and counseling in Kenya dates back to the early 1960s when guidance and counseling units were established in schools. The field has evolved over the years to incorporate psychological and career counseling services at both individual and group levels. The government has made efforts to integrate guidance and counseling services into the education system to promote holistic student development.
